New PB and.........World Record!

As promised I gave the 4:00 another go. I decided to warm-up to see how I felt before deciding and I felt pretty good. I then programmed the 4:00 and figured I would start into it and if I didn't have it I would just stop but 2:00 in I was hurting but knew I was in a good rhythm and had some left in the tank. I wanted 1300 as the WR was 1298 and this was right near 1:32 so my plan was to average 1:32 and the 1:00 splits ended up at 1:31.7, 1:32.3,1:32.0 and 1:31.8. for a 1:31.9 average and 1305 meters -36 SPM. First minute I did some hard pulls to get going and drive down pace and then settled right on 1:32, mostly held that for the next 2 minutes and fought the mental demons. With one minute left I was really worried about falling apart and I actually increased SPM and pace for a bit to try and counteract it and seemed to work but then I started "freezing up" some and held on the best I could, last 15-20 seconds I faded but had built a little cushion and hit goal (over goal). I was absolutely crushed after but then actually recovered better once I did a cool-down row and such - more so than usual.

I entered the score with verification on C2 Site and it shows properly in rankings but not sure if I need to submit anywhere else to have WR updated.
